Attendees reviewed the decision to move carriage from Helmsro Freight to Quillar Transport effective next quarter. Quillar's bid was 11% lower and includes cold-chain capacity for the Dairen depot. Risks discussed: contract exit penalties with Helmsro, estimated at one month's fees, and a two-week overlap period to protect delivery continuity. Operations will report weekly during the transition. Finance confirmed no material impact on the annual plan. The confidential note on forward business plans is recorded directly below.

board note of kageg-bahof: The renewal with Holwynax Holdings closes at $2 million a year, 5 percent below the last contract. Project Ulaath slips by two quarters because of the supplier delay.

**Ticket #— LockerLoop creds expired**

Hey on-call — the laundry-locker access flow on Fernwhistle is bouncing everyone at the door-unlock step. Turns out the service credential for the locker gateway expired overnight and nobody got the renewal reminder. I've minted a fresh one already; just swap it into the gateway config and restart. New key for the gateway is below.

API key for yahig-tadup: kto7_ubizbYm

# Break-Glass: Catalog Cache Invalidation

Scope: the Pinrow product catalog at Veldstone Retail. If stale prices persist after a purge and the Hollowmere invalidation queue is wedged, use break-glass to flush the edge tier directly. Contractors: get verbal sign-off from the catalog lead first. Steps: open the Hollowmere admin shell, select emergency-flush, confirm the tenant, and run it once — repeated flushes thrash the origin. Access is logged and expires after 20 minutes. Unseal the admin shell with the passphrase below.

recovery phrase for kahop-tajog: istix-casvan

Ticket WIKI-883: Role-based access changes in Hollowpage v3 affect plugin hooks. Plugins can no longer read page ACLs directly; use the new permissions API. Legacy hook read_acl() will be removed next release. External plugin authors: test against the sandbox and report breakage on this ticket. Ships only after sign-off from the access-control owner named below.

account owner for bawip-tahag: Raleth Quenok